The Tudors: Henry VIII - Government under Henry VIII and Wolsey - Episode 15
In this video, we look at the government in the early years of Henry VIII's reign. Thomas Wolsey was the man who presided over this government and he introduced both legal and financial reforms. Some of these reforms such as the Court of Chancery were considered successfully whereas others like the Amicable Grant in 1525 can be considered a major failure.
